Gut Steinbach – Frequently Asked Questions
Those visiting Reit im Winkl for the first time often have questions. Here are the most common answers.
What makes Gut Steinbach special?
Gut Steinbach is a Relais & Châteaux hotel with its own 51-hectare farm, seven detached chalets, a 2,000-square-meter SPA, and a restaurant with a Green Michelin Star. What sets it apart from other establishments in Chiemgau is the combination of nature, agriculture, culinary excellence, and hospitality under one roof—or rather, on one estate.
How far is Gut Steinbach from Munich and Salzburg?
From Munich, it is about 110 km, approximately 1.5 hours by car. From Salzburg, it is about 75 km, roughly a one-hour drive. Kitzbühel can be reached in about 40 minutes, and Lake Chiemsee in around 30 minutes.
Is Gut Steinbach open all year round?
Yes, Gut Steinbach is open year-round. In winter, the nearby ski areas of Winklmoosalm (10 km) and Hochkössen (14 min) are a major draw; in summer, it’s hiking, mountain biking, and the lakes around Reit im Winkl. The Heimat & Natur SPA is available daily throughout the year from 7:00 AM to 8:00 PM.
Are dogs welcome?
Yes, dogs are welcome in almost all rooms, suites, and chalets. The surcharge is €30 per dog per night, with a maximum of two dogs per unit. A dog blanket and bowl will be waiting in the room. Gut Steinbach reserves the right to charge a fee for final cleaning.
